Staying Safe After A Flash Flood or Severe Storm Flooding

Flash floods and unplanned storm flooding can be devastating, striking with little warning and causing significant damage to communities. Once the immediate danger has passed, it’s essential to prioritize safety and take careful steps to recover. Here’s a comprehensive guide on how to stay safe after a flash flood.

  1. Ensure Personal Safety

Contact local authorities to inform of the flood (if applicable) such as FEMA Assistance for Texans | FEMA.govWear waterproof boots, gloves and masks to protect yourself from contaminants in floodwaters (sewage, chemical, debris, etc.).

Stay away from floodwaters, they can be contaminated or hide unstable grounds. 

  1. Inspect for Hazards

Structural Damage: Look out for visible structural damage. If you notice any signs of instability, do not enter your home.

Electrical Hazards: Avoid downed power lines and electrical equipment that may be wet. Assume all downed wires are “live” and dangerous.

Gas Leaks:
If you smell gas or head a hissing sound, evacuate immediately and call emergency services.

There are several disaster relief locations available (DRC Locator (fema.gov)) if your home has hazards.

  1. Document the Damage

Take Photos and Videos: Document the damage for property insurance claims.

Contact your Insurance Company: Notify them as soon as possible; provide them with the photos/videos and file a claim.
